10 facts about this song
Song Identity"Last Cup of Sorrow" is a popular song released by the American rock band Faith No More. It's the seventh track on their sixth studio album, titled "Album of the Year."
|
Release DateThe song was released as a single in the year 1997.
|
Music GenreLike most of Faith No More's songs, "Last Cup of Sorrow" belongs to the genres of alternative metal, experimental rock, and funk metal.
|
Songwriting CreditsThe song was penned by the band members Mike Patton, Billy Gould, Mike Bordin, and Roddy Bottum.
|
Music VideoThe music video for "Last Cup of Sorrow" is noteworthy. It is a parody of Alfred Hitchcock's classic film "Vertigo," and features actress Jennifer Jason Leigh.
|
Chart PerformanceDespite its popularity and critical acclaim, the song didn't chart extensively. However, it did make it to number 14 on the Mainstream Rock Tracks.
|
Other MediaThe song was featured in episodes of "Beavis and Butt-Head," and was also included in the soundtrack for the film "Highway."
|
Awards and NominationsThe music video received a nomination at the MTV Video Music Awards for best editing in 1998.
|
Critical Reception"Last Cup of Sorrow" received a positive response from critics and fans alike, with many appreciating its unique sound and engaging lyrics.
|
Album's SuccessWhile "Last Cup of Sorrow" was a standalone hit from the album, it contributed to the overall success of the Album of the Year, which was certified Gold in Australia and Platinum in New Zealand.
